Is cauliflower a flower or bud?
The cauliflower head is composed of a white inflorescence meristem and it resembles those in broccoli, which differs in having flower buds as the edible portion. Thus the edible part of cauliflower is the inflorescence and in broccoli, the edible part is the bud.
Is the head of a cauliflower a flower?
Descended from wild cabbage, cauliflowers once closely resembled kale or collards. These days, cauliflowers form a compacted head of undeveloped white flower buds called the “curd”. A tight encasing of heavy green leaves surrounds these buds.

What is the edible part of a cauliflower plant?
Typically, only the head is eaten – the edible white flesh sometimes called “curd” (with a similar appearance to cheese curd). The cauliflower head is composed of a white inflorescence meristem. Cauliflower heads resemble those in broccoli, which differs in having flower buds as the edible portion.

Is cabbage a flower or stem?
Cabbage is the plant’s vegetative bud, according to morphology. It is made up of the growing stem’s tip and rounded, overlapping leaves. Thus, the bud of the plant is cabbage. Note: Cabbage is grown primarily for its densely leaved heads, which appear during the first year of its biennial cycle.

What does cauliflower flower look like?
Flowering cauliflower has long, loose, thin, tender stems with tiny cream-colored florets. It resembles the baby’s breath (gypsophila) flowers used in a bridal bouquet, which makes flowering cauliflower kind of an edible bouquet! It looks like a cross between cauliflower and broccolini.
Is cauliflower leaf edible?
You can eat cauliflower leaves. They’re just as edible as the cauliflower stems or florets (the immature flowers of the plant) we usually cook up. They’re also a versatile ingredient which adds tasty flavour to many dishes.
